Verdict

LUCIDITY stepped up on her exploits in novice/maiden company when third on handicap debut at Nottingham (8.3f) 30 days ago and, less exposed than most, she could be the answer now stepping up in trip. Gallimimus for George Boughey can emerge as the chief threat.
